New York, NY: The Ramapo College women's indoor track and field team competed at the NYI DIII Invitational today at the Armory.
Dale Leonard paced the Roadrunners at the meet as she set a new program record in the 800m race along with the #10 DIII season best time of 2:12.53. Leonard's time is also #1 in the Metro Region by over three seconds.

Ramapo returns to action on Feb. 21st and 22nd when they travel to the NJAC Indoor Championships at the University of Pennsylvania.
